Description
I was wondering what the current status is for running bashunit on Windows OS ?
I thought it was supported, but I'm not having much luck getting it running on Windows.
Examples:
$ bashunit --help
****** B A T C H R E C U R S I O N exceeds STACK limits ******
Recursion Count=339, Stack Usage=90 percent
****** B A T C H PROCESSING IS A B O R T E D ******
$ bashunit --version
****** B A T C H R E C U R S I O N exceeds STACK limits ******
Recursion Count=339, Stack Usage=90 percent
****** B A T C H PROCESSING IS A B O R T E D ******
$ bashunit --init tests
****** B A T C H R E C U R S I O N exceeds STACK limits ******
Recursion Count=339, Stack Usage=90 percent
****** B A T C H PROCESSING IS A B O R T E D ******
Additional info
In case it helps, this is how I downloaded and am running bashunit
:
- Downloaded the latest version straight from the Releases page.
- Placed it in a directory in the Windows
PATH
. - Tried to run it unsuccessfully ("'bashunit' is not recognized as an internal or external command, operable program or batch file.").
- Added a
bashunit.bat
file with the following contents in the same directory as thebashunit
file:@echo off call "bashunit" %* ECHO Exit code is %errorlevel%
- Got it running, but not working (see above).
